Output d82cae135fc2aeee433513e0d871cef06439c838a31d0447c937323ccf64b133:2

value
9554962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568c2e5e5974ec6c319cd0984d30e0eb973d6bf3 OP_EQUAL
address
MFnnGtAubD4fY7N7gjUKBDE8LzMpqPFJ8L
transaction
d82cae135fc2aeee433513e0d871cef06439c838a31d0447c937323ccf64b133
spent
true